Currently one of my '23 Lariat's battery modules is dead causing the battery to only charge to 62%. Weirdly enough I have no dash lights, but limited to 50% power and an OBD reader gave me a "battery voltage imbalance" error. Have an appointment on the 16th, and I can update people on how long a replacement module takes if they're curious.

Prior to this, the only issue I had was the frunk not power opening all the way (which was fixed during an OTA update??) and the bonded neutral on the ProPower system causing some weird issues. 14tb Seagate IronWolf PRO on discount by huseynli in HomeNAS

[–]Zuexs 2 points3 points  (0 children)

For the Zimaboard with even one of these drives you'll absolutely need an external PSU. 3.5" HDDs take quite a bit of power on spin-up. They do make external SATA PSUs which could work for you.

Nozzle heating error by iskandar711 in AnkerMake

[–]Zuexs 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I've had the same error several times, my issue was the ambient air temperature in the room. Anything above 80F made mine error out. If you have an air-conditioned space, test it in there and see if you get the same error.
